Pinpoint #169: typed-error classifier gap discovered during dogfood probe. `claw --output-format json --output-format xml doctor` was emitting: {"error": "unsupported value for --output-format: xml ...", "hint": null, "kind": "unknown", "type": "error"} After fix: {"error": "unsupported value for --output-format: xml ...", "hint": "Run `claw --help` for usage.", "kind": "cli_parse", "type": "error"} The change adds two new classifier branches to `classify_error_kind`: 1. `unsupported value for --` → cli_parse 2. `missing value for --` → cli_parse Covers all `CliOutputFormat::parse` / `parse_permission_mode_arg` rejections and any future flag-value validation messages using the same pattern. Side benefit: the #247 hint synthesizer ("Run `claw --help` for usage.") now triggers automatically because the error is now correctly classified as cli_parse. Consumers get both correct kind AND helpful hint. Test added: - `classify_error_kind_covers_flag_value_parse_errors_169` (4 positive + 1 sanity case) Tests: 224/224 pass (+1 from #169).
